Types of BMW Keys
BMW uses numerous types of keys, each designed for different designs and years. Here is a breakdown of the main kinds of keys available:
TypeDescriptionStandard KeySimple metal key without electronic components.Remote KeyKey with a remote control for locking and opening.Smart KeyKey fob with advanced functions, consisting of keyless entry and start.Key CardThin, card-like key utilized in some electrical models (e.g., BMW i3).Remote Key vs. Smart Key: Which One Do You Have?
While both remote keys and wise keys offer convenience, they differ in performance:

Remote Keys: Usually need the motorist to press a button to unlock the doors or trunk and might not provide a push-to-start feature.

Smart Keys: Employ proximity sensing units to unlock doors automatically when the key fob is nearby and allow the chauffeur to start the engine with a push of a button.

It is important for BMW owners to understand which type of key they have to assist in a smoother replacement procedure.
The Key Replacement Process
Replacing a BMW key can involve a number of actions, depending upon the kind of key and the owner's circumstances. Here's an overview of the common process:
1. Recognize the Key Type
Before any replacement can occur, owners should ascertain the type of key they require to Replace BMW Key. This information can normally be discovered in the owner's handbook or through the BMW car dealership.
2. Collect Necessary Documentation
When approaching a dealership or a locksmith for a key replacement, particular documents are generally required:
Proof of Ownership: This can be the lorry title or registration.Identification: A driver's license or another kind of ID may be necessary.Car Identification Number (VIN): This unique code can normally be discovered on the dashboard or in the owner's handbook.3. Contact a Dealership or Certified Locksmith
BMW keys, specifically smart keys and remote keys, are frequently geared up with chips and require special shows. For that reason, the most reputable choice is usually to contact an authorized BMW car dealership. Some certified locksmith professionals likewise have the devices to replace and set BMW keys.
4. Programming the New Key
After the new key is physically gotten, it needs to be programmed to deal with your specific car. This process generally takes place at the dealership or locksmith and might include linking the car to specialized software.
5. Receive the Replacement Key
As soon as the New BMW Key Fob key is programmed and tested, the owner will receive it. It is recommended to test all key functions upon receiving to guarantee they work as anticipated.
Cost of BMW Key Replacement
The expenses connected with replacing a BMW New Key key can vary substantially based upon a number of factors, consisting of the kind of key and the company. Below is a summary of approximated costs:

Can I replace my BMW key myself?
While some may attempt to replace their BMW Key Battery Replacement Near Me key through DIY techniques, the generally intricate nature of key programming makes it suggested to seek expert aid.
2. For how long does it take to get a replacement key?
The time it takes to receive a replacement key can vary. Dealers might require a few days depending on whether the key remains in stock, while locksmiths can typically offer quicker service but may not have access to all types of keys.
3. Will losing my key affect my car's security?
Losing a key can leave your car susceptible. It's a good idea to ask for a key reset or reprogramming if the key is lost to guarantee that nobody can exploit the lost key.
4. What should I do if my key fob is malfunctioning?
If a key fob breakdowns, it's normally due to a dead battery or internal damage. Replacing the battery may resolve the problem, however if it continues, a replacement might be needed.
5. Exist any service warranties for replacement keys?
Some dealerships provide guarantees on their keys, which can cover certain problems or concerns. It's vital to ask throughout the replacement procedure.
